Output fccdc0226de5b9755de4094e763128b34b51e3949c95bc57f3d112c7e4ba27cb:6

value
4166384
script pubkey
OP_0 OP_PUSHBYTES_20 586e2f87da0870ace8aa3e48dec71b867a0050ac
address
bc1qtphzlp76ppc2e6928eyda3cmseaqq59v28xgnw
transaction
fccdc0226de5b9755de4094e763128b34b51e3949c95bc57f3d112c7e4ba27cb
spent
true